Camilo

Camilo is a name of Latin origin meaning 'attendant' or 'helper.' It conveys a sense of support and dedication, often associated with individuals who are caring and reliable. Those named Camilo are often seen as warm and approachable, embodying a spirit of community and camaraderie.

Notable People

Camilo Echeverry (Colombian singer-songwriter, *Tutu*) · Camilo José Cela (Spanish novelist, *The Family of Pascual Duarte*) · Camilo Cienfuegos (Cuban revolutionary leader) · Camilo Villegas (Colombian professional golfer) · Camilo Sesto (Spanish singer-songwriter)
